एक्सेल: वीबीए के माध्यम से स्ट्रिंग्स, अक्षरों और संख्याओं की खोज करें - इसे इस तरह से किया गया है

विषय - सूची

मैक्रो का उपयोग करके अक्षरों और अंकों की गणना कैसे करें

आप विशिष्ट ग्रंथों, संख्याओं, अक्षरों और संख्याओं के अनुक्रम की खोज के लिए "संपादित करें - खोजें" फ़ंक्शन का उपयोग कर सकते हैं। आप अपनी तालिकाओं में वर्णों को खोजने के लिए मैक्रो का उपयोग भी कर सकते हैं।

निम्नलिखित मैक्रो सामग्री के लिए उपयोगकर्ता से पूछताछ करता है और पहले चयनित सेल श्रेणी में इस सामग्री की खोज करता है। इसलिए पहले अपनी तालिका में एक क्षेत्र चुनें और फिर निम्नलिखित मैक्रो को सक्रिय करें:

उप गणना वर्ण ()
डिम आई ऐज़ लॉन्ग
लंबे समय तक मंद स्थिति
स्ट्रिंग के रूप में मंद चिह्न
रेंज के रूप में मंद सेल
एक स्ट्रिंग के रूप में मंद करें
कैरेक्टर = इनपुटबॉक्स ("आप किस कैरेक्टर को गिनना चाहते हैं?")
मैं = 0
चयन में प्रत्येक सेल के लिए
स्थिति = InStr (1, UCase (सेल.वैल्यू), UCase (चरित्र))
जबकि स्थिति 0
मैं = मैं + 1
स्थिति = InStr (स्थिति + लेन (चरित्र), सेल। मान, वर्ण)
बीतना
अगली सेल
ए = संदेशबॉक्स ("स्ट्रिंग" और चरित्र और "बन गया" _
& i & "मिला समय।", vbOKOnly, "खोज परिणाम")
अंत उप

पहले चरण में, मैक्रो एक विंडो में पूछता है कि आप चिह्नित क्षेत्र में किस वर्ण को खोजना चाहते हैं:

फिर सेल रेंज की खोज की जाती है। एक परिणाम विंडो आपको दिखाती है कि आप जिस चरित्र की तलाश कर रहे थे वह कितनी बार मिला:

खोज केस-संवेदी है। आप उन स्ट्रिंग्स को भी खोज सकते हैं जो किसी अक्षर या संख्या से अधिक लंबी हों। अक्षरों के अलावा, आप संख्याओं या अक्षरों और संख्याओं के संयोजन भी खोज सकते हैं।

युक्ति: यदि आप जानना चाहते हैं कि एक्सेल में मैक्रो कैसे दर्ज करें और शुरू करें, तो आपको यहां एक संक्षिप्त विवरण मिलेगा: http://www.exceldaily.de/excel-makros-vba/artikel/d/so-haben-sie -macros- in-excel-ein.html

आप साइट के विकास में मदद मिलेगी, अपने दोस्तों के साथ साझा करने पेज

wave wave wave wave wave